Editorial Notes

A compelling Social Media Editor resume for the Marketing & Advertising industry must highlight concrete, quantifiable impact. Hiring managers seek evidence of successful content strategy, audience engagement growth, and platform-specific expertise across channels like Instagram, TikTok, and LinkedIn. Demonstrating achievements such as “increased Instagram engagement by 40%” or “grew follower count by 25%” resonates strongly. Key terminology like A/B testing, community management, and content calendar development should be present. Certifications such as Meta Blueprint or Google Analytics show commitment to best practices.

Frequently Asked Questions

For a mid-level Social Media Editor, a chronological resume format is generally best to showcase your career progression. Start with a compelling professional summary that highlights your content curation, editing, and strategy skills. Follow with a 'Skills' section listing relevant software and platforms. The 'Experience' section should detail your work in content planning, editing, scheduling, and optimizing social media posts for engagement and brand voice.
